- the invention relates to a sawing device according to the preamble of the claim 1 or claim 9 and a stop according to the preamble of Claim 10.
- Sawing devices of the type in question have a saw table that in is generally stable and forms the base frame of the sawing device (DE 40 10 456 C2).
- the saw table usually has a workpiece support surface on which the workpiece to be machined rests.
- a saw unit Arranged on the saw table and connected to it is a saw unit which has a saw blade rotatable about an axis of rotation.
- the saw unit has further a drive preferably designed as an electric or pneumatic motor for the saw blade.
- the saw unit When the saw device is designed as a cross-cut saw, the saw unit is around a pivot axis running parallel to the axis of rotation of the saw blade swiveling to control the sawing process accordingly.
- the saw unit When designing as a table saw, on the other hand, the saw unit is below the saw table fixed. The saw blade protrudes from a slot in the saw table out. The workpiece is "pulled" past the saw unit.
- the stops can be in their dimensions, their shape or differ in their constructive design.
- the sawing device, from which the invention is based therefore has stops that with mounting clips on special mounts - clip-on workpiece stop rails are (DE 90 03 773 U1). With this stop concept it is possible the stops between two different sawing orders as required and swap without much effort.
- the invention is therefore based on the problem of the known sawing device to design and develop such that the interchangeability of the strokes given constant manufacturing accuracy.
- the present problem is first solved by a sawing device Claim 1 solved.
- an adjustable adjustment device for fine positioning the stop on the saw table is provided, which is their setting when dismantling and the installation of the stop.
- Such an adjusting device has the advantage that during disassembly and subsequent Assembly, or when changing the stop no renewed fine positioning is required.
- the adjusting device is separate from a fastening device of the stop arranged on the stop itself. With the separation between the adjustment device and the fastening device achieved that the forces to be applied during the attachment do not affect the setting of the adjustment device. With the arrangement of the adjustment device at the stop itself it is achieved that the associated stop Adjustment of the adjustment device when dismantling the stop "taken away".

- Fig. 1 shows the overall structure of the sawing device according to the invention.
- the sawing device has a saw table 1, which in the present case represents the base frame and has a workpiece support surface 2. Arranged at the saw table 1 and the saw unit 3 is mechanically coupled to this. Next is the saw table 1 a stop running essentially over the width of the saw table 1 4 provided.
- the saw unit 3 has a rotatable about an axis of rotation 5 Saw blade 6, which is driven by an electric motor 7.
- the saw unit 3 is in the present case about a parallel to the axis of rotation 5 of the saw blade 6 Swivel axis 8 swiveling. This is the design the sawing device as a crosscut saw.
- a workpiece is brought into contact with the stop 4 for processing, so that the workpiece has a clear orientation with respect to the saw blade 6.
- the stop 4 is connected to the saw table 1 by a fastening device 9 releasably connected.
- the fastening device 9 is in the embodiment 1 realized as a screw connection, the screw connection on the stop side has an elongated hole. This slot has just so much play that a fine positioning of the stop 4 is possible.
- An adjustment device 10 is provided for performing the fine positioning, which is configured separately from the fastening device 9.
- the special one Advantage of this separate configuration of fastening device 9 and Adjustment device 10 is that the forceful operation of the fastening device 9 does not affect the setting of the adjusting device 10.
- the adjusting device 10 is arranged on the stop 4. But it can also be provided that the adjusting device 10 on Saw table 1 is provided, but then it must be accepted that only a single adjustment of the adjusting device 10 for all the substitutes Stops 4 is possible.
- the adjusting device 10 at least one adjusting screw 11, which in one at the stop 4 arranged threaded hole is screwed.
- Fig. 2 shows how that in the drawing right end of the adjusting screw 11 in contact with the saw table 1 comes, so that with the stop 4 mounted, the fine positioning of the stop 4 is possible in the plane of the workpiece support surface 2.
- the adjusting screw 11 has a supporting function, that is, forces via the adjusting screw 11 are transmitted or that the adjusting screw 11 only in this way comes into contact with the saw table 1, that it essentially with the stop 4 attached is free of strength.
- Fig. 3 shows the stop 4 of the sawing device according to the invention in perspective View.
- There are two adjusting screws for the adjusting device 10 11 are provided, which are each arranged on one end side of the stop 4 (in 3 only the threaded holes can be seen). With this two-sided Arrangement of the adjusting screws 11 is an optimal fine positioning given over the entire length of the stop 4. In a simple design but it can also be provided that only one adjusting screw 11 is provided which is preferably arranged on one of the two end sides of the stop 4 is.
- the adjusting screw 11 is designed to be self-locking, or that the adjusting screw 11 is provided with an appropriate lock nut. Especially against the background that the adjustment of the adjustment device 10 during disassembly and subsequent assembly of the stop 4 is to be maintained, this is special advantageous.
